Hey everyone. Just getting the word out that Eugene Bessette from Ophiological Services will be here in Kansas City, Missouri on Saturday, January 10th, 2004. He will be giving a talk at the KC Herp Sociey meeting, which is held at 1:00 pm at William Chrisman Highschool (24 Hiway & Noland Rd., Independence, Missouri).

There is no admission fee. There will be a raffle, a nice selection of herp related books for sale, and possibly even some animals, should anyone choose to bring some to sell. By the way, the Kansas City Herp Society is a non-profit organization, so all proceeds will go towards herp conservation.

The talk will encompass herpetoculture as a whole, where herpetoculture came from and where it's headed, the money side of it, and the people that make it happen. And of course, we'll talk about pythons. In addition to Eugene's talk, we'll have a raffle, and there will be books and even a few reptiles for sale.

As you all know, Eugene has been breeding Chondros since the mid 1970's. He worked right along side Trooper to help develop the "formula" for artificially incubating Chondro eggs, and he's been doing it ever since. Now Ophiological Services also works with all kinds of other stuff, from Ball Morphs to Blood Pythons and of course, their famous Chondros.
